RAMALLAH, June 25, 2011 (WAFA) - Ukrainian officials Saturday asserted their country’s recognition of a Palestinian state and understanding of the Palestinian Authority’s (PA) efforts to seek UN recognition next September.
Fatah Central Committee Member, Nabil Sha’ath, during an official visit to Ukraine, said that he felt the officials political support and understanding of the Palestinian demands.
He said, “I briefed the Ukrainian officials on the Palestinian goals and the importance of UN recognition next September, especially during a sensitive period of time, in which the PA is having an international campaign to insure our rights and face the Israeli intransigence.”
Shaath affirmed the importance of coordinating with the Ukrainian government to reach a good stance, which reflects the Palestinian-Ukrainian relations.
He called on the Arab ambassadors to Ukraine to unite the Arab stance, continue explaining the Palestinian leadership’s stances and pressure the Ukrainian government to support the PA.
